Ingredients:
• 15 – baby Corn
• 3 – Potatoes
• Salt to taste
• 1/2 cup – small Onions
• 3 – Tomatoes
• 1/2 tsp – Cumin seeds
• 1 tbsp – oil
• 1/4 cup – water
• For grinding:
• 2 – Onions
• 2 – Garlic Cloves
• 1 tbsp – Mint leaves
• 1 tbsp – Coriander leaves
• 1/4 tsp – Red Chilli powder
• 1 – Green chilli
• 1 tbsp – oil
• 1/2 tsp – coriander powder
• 1 tbsp – Garam Masala powder
• 10 – Cashew nuts
• Salt to taste
Method:
- Chop the onions and keep it aside.
- Soak the tomatoes in boiling water and remove the skin. Grind the tomatoes and keep it aside.
- Pressure cook the potatoes and baby corn.
- Remove the potato skin and mash the potatoes.
- Heat oil in a pan and add cumin seeds.
- When the cumin seeds start to sputter, add onions and fry till it becomes transparent.
- Grind the masala ingredients and add it to the frying onions.
- Add the tomato paste. Mix well and fry.
- Add the cooked corn, mashed potatoes and salt. Mix well.
- Add 1/4 cup water and allow the masala to boil and thicken.
- Serve with rotis.
